Poultry > Coconut Chicken

From the kitchen of South Beach Diet Cookbook

If Bali is the ultimate island, then this dinner is the ultimate Bali taste. Chicken braised in coconut milk (Opor Ayam) is a true classic of Indonesian fare. We did change the chicken to white meat instead of the traditional drumstick or wing. New traditions can sometimes be better than old ones.

Makes 4 servings.

Sauces & Relishes > Garam Masala

From the kitchen of Julie Sahni

This is the most aromatic and fragrant of all Indian spice blends. Used throughout North India in all types of dishes − from appetizers and soups to yogurt salad and main courses − this blend is indispensable to Moghul and North Indian cooking. It is widely available, but my homemade version is more fragrant and, of course, fresher.
